  • Who you are

    We are looking for Food Operations Leader in IKEA Korea. This person is responsible to lead the food operational excellence and ensure a commercial food experience that is safe, people and planet positive, healthy and delicious, affordable and convenient, human and joyful, with a Swedish touch.
    This position is report to Country Food Manager in IKEA Korea Service Office.

    Your responsibilities

    • Coach, and re-direct where necessary, the units to drive food operational excellence – in-store logistics, food production, meeting the customer, equipment and sustainable operations
    • Ensure that food operations are compliant with IKEA standards and local legal demands
    • Responsible for monitoring units in order to identify and optimize food operational needs and requirements
    • Contribute to food business financial results through monitoring the performance, identifying gaps and proposing and initiating improvements
    • Contribute insight and ideas to the market business plan as an integrated commercial partner
    • Responsible for developing and implementing common operational framework, standards, plans, WoW (way of working), tools and KPI’s to deliver to the business goals
    • Ensure correct operational process to secure food product availability, food stock management, food quality and to minimize food waste
    • Ensure up to date, appropriate and sustainable equipment and facilities
    • Contribute to the development of market specific range operational needs and requirements in line with IKEA range strategy, requirements and processes
    • Plan, conduct and follow-up operational performance review as well as act upon them e.g. lead information and escalation process to ensure performance excellence throughout the year
    • Train co-workers in new food production, serving techniques and tools as well as ways of working
    • Contribute with knowledge transfer and information sharing to, and between, the units
    • Act as a member of the food team and proactively contribute to food plan/output in order to deliver to the common objectives and goals
    • Actively cooperate with all key stakeholders within commercial and beyond to secure integration, common focus and to maximize impact (for example Digital, CFF (Customer Fulfilment), Communications, Sustainability, BNOF (Business Navigation Operations & Finance), People & Culture)
    • Be an active player in working on sustainability within food (sourcing of local ingredients, circularity in production, usage of sustainable materials and services)
    • Be an active player in driving an open and sharing climate, be a role model of the IKEA values and contribute to the transformation of IKEA
